var regexEnum =
{
 intege:"^-?[1-9]//d*$",     //整数
 intege1:"^[1-9]//d*$",     //正整数
 intege2:"^-[1-9]//d*$",     //负整数
 num:"^([+-]?)//d*//.?//d+$",   //数字
 num1:"^([1-9]//d*|0)$",     //正数(正整数 + 0)
 num2:"^-[1-9]//d*|0$",     //负数(负整数 + 0)
 decmal:"^([+-]?)//d*//.//d+$",   //浮点数
 decmal1:"^[1-9]//d*.//d*|0.//d*[1-9]//d*$",   //正浮点数
 decmal2:"^-([1-9]//d*.//d*|0.//d*[1-9]//d*)$",  //负浮点数
 decmal3:"^-?([1-9]//d*.//d*|0.//d*[1-9]//d*|0?.0+|0)$",  //浮点数
 decmal4:"^[1-9]//d*.//d*|0.//d*[1-9]//d*|0?.0+|0$",   //非负浮点数(正浮点数 + 0)
 decmal5:"^(-([1-9]//d*.//d*|0.//d*[1-9]//d*))|0?.0+|0$",  //非正浮点数(负浮点数 + 0)

email:"^//w+((-//w+)|(//.//w+))*//@[A-Za-z0-9]+((//.|-)[A-Za-z0-9]+)*//.[A-Za-z0-9]+$", //邮件
 color:"^[a-fA-F0-9]{6}$",    //颜色
 url:"^http[s]?://([//w-]+//.)+[//w-]+([//w-./?%&=]*)?$", //url
 chinese:"^[//u4E00-//u9FA5//uF900-//uFA2D]+$",     //仅中文
 ascii:"^[//x00-//xFF]+$",    //仅ACSII字符
 zipcode:"^//d{6}$",      //邮编
 mobile:"^(13|15|18)[0-9]{9}$",    //手机
 ip4:"^(25[0-5]|2[0-4]//d|[0-1]//d{2}|[1-9]?//d)//.(25[0-5]|2[0-4]//d|[0-1]//d{2}|[1-9]?//d)//.(25[0-5]|2[0-4]//d|[0-1]//d{2}|[1-9]?//d)//.(25[0-5]|2[0-4]//d|[0-1]//d{2}|[1-9]?//d)$", //ip地址
 notempty:"^//S+$",      //非空
 picture:"(.*)//.(jpg|bmp|gif|ico|pcx|jpeg|tif|png|raw|tga)$", //图片
 rar:"(.*)//.(rar|zip|7zip|tgz)$",        //压缩文件
 date:"^//d{4}(//-|///|/.)//d{1,2}//1//d{1,2}$",     //日期
 qq:"^[1-9]*[1-9][0-9]*$",    //QQ号码
 tel:"^(([0//+]//d{2,3}-)?(0//d{2,3})-)?(//d{7,8})(-(//d{3,}))?$", //电话号码的函数(包括验证国内区号,国际区号,分机号)
 username:"^//w+$",      //用来用户注册。匹配由数字、26个英文字母或者下划线组成的字符串
 letter:"^[A-Za-z]+$",     //字母
 letter_u:"^[A-Z]+$",     //大写字母
 letter_l:"^[a-z]+$",     //小写字母
 idcard:"^[1-9]([0-9]{14}|[0-9]{17})$" //身份证
}

转载于:https://www.cnblogs.com/hanwenhua/articles/3255585.html

常用的JQuery数字类型验证正则表达式相关推荐

  1. UI组件库Form表单_数字类型验证之坑实现数字框

    目录 Input 输入框 实现数字框封装使用 项目需求 : 使用的饿了么组件库的 input 框 , 但是想要 实现用户只能输入 数字 的功能 , So 看到了数字类型的验证 (缺点 :不能阻止用户输 ...

  2. JS Number对象常用函数(数字类型常用函数)

    Number 属性 属性 描述 Number.MAX_VALUE 最大值 Number.MIN_VALUE 最小值 Number.NaN 非数字 Number.NEGATIVE_INFINITY 负无 ...

  3. 常用正则:身份证号码验证正则表达式

    需要一个简单的验证身份证号的正则表达式,从网上查了很多,都有问题,主要是只要超过15位,都能够通过,于是自己查了半天手册,写了下面这个式子,能够满足简单的要求: 1.15位或18位,如果是15位,必需 ...

  4. java 判断是否是小数_java判断数字类型(小数和整数)

    展开全部 java判断数字类型32313133353236313431303231363533e4b893e5b19e31333366306532是否为小数,可以采用正则表达式的方式来判断,以下是使用 ...

  5. js 验证各种格式类型的正则表达式

    <script src="scripts/jquery-1.4.1.js" type="text/javascript"></script&g ...

  6. 数字类型及常用的数学函数(Python)

    int(整数类型) 与数学中的整数一致,没有取值范围的限制.其有四种表示方式:十进制,二进制,八进制,十六进制.在Python中,默认为十进制表示方式,用其他方式,需添加引导符. 二进制引导符:0b或 ...

  7. ACCESS常用数字类型的说明和取值范围

    下面是ACCESS常用数字类型的说明和取值范围列表明供参考 数字类型                 范围 Byte(字节)            介于 0 到 255 之间的整型数. Integer ...

  8. python常用的数字类型方法_python基础--数据类型的常用方法1

    1.数字类型 整型 用途:存qq号,手机号,不带字母的身份证号... 进制转换: 二进制转十进制:10 -->  1*(2**1) + 0*(2**0) 2 八进制转十进制:  235  --& ...

  9. python定义int变量_Python变量以及常用数字类型(上)

    好好学习,天天向上.又到了齐小猴写笔记的时间,今天的内容是python 变量以及常用数字类型,废话不多说,撸起袖子开始写 变量 1.说到变量,先回顾上一篇说过的标识符,自己定义,自己命名,由字母,下划 ...

最新文章

  1. OSChina 周二乱弹 ——在影楼工作的妹子,可追不?
  2. 服务器显示器切换_尼某某 DDOS 攻击高德,致使服务器处于黑洞状态 5 个多小时:被判 16 个月...
  3. 光谱分类算法 matlab,Matlab K-means聚类算法对多光谱遥感图像进行分类(一)
  4. Java Spring源码研究之BeanNameUrlHandlerMapping
  5. 【笔记】跨域重定向中使用Ajax(XHR请求)导致跨域失败
  6. JAVA自学笔记08
  7. CentOS 6.5自动化运维之基于DHCP和TFTP服务的PXE自动化安装centos操作系统详解
  8. Maven多个mudule只编译、打包指定module
  9. python网络爬虫学习笔记(七):正则表达式
  10. MAC 打开safari和Chrome打开开发者工具的快捷键
  11. MIND新闻推荐冠军分享细节揭秘
  12. jmeter中通过命令方式生成结果文件
  13. 发电厂电气部分第三版pdf_发电厂电气部分 第三版 习题参考答案
  14. 计算机职业素养论文1500字,【如何提高职业素养1500字】_个人职业素养提升计划1500字范文...
  15. 数据挖掘-基于随机森林模型的企业偷漏税纳税人识别
  16. extends和implement的区别
  17. 软件过程模型的管道理论
  18. linux io page fault,Linux的page fault
  19. PHP数组关于数字键名的问题
  20. 电脑录屏软件帧率设置详解

热门文章

  1. Mysql实现非程序控制读写分离
  2. NSHelper.showAlertTitle的两种用法 swift
  3. 微软云计算业务增长,或成全球最具价值上市公司
  4. (一)Android Studio 安装部署 华丽躲坑
  5. SpringBoot的修改操作
  6. 基于tcp和udp的socket实现
  7. 全球物联网产业规模不断扩大 中国市场前景分析
  8. 如何设置 Linux 上 SSH 登录的 Email 提醒
  9. css中关于居中的那点事儿
  10. jPA自动创建数据库表的一些配置